LOS ANGELES, Nov. 28, 2016 /PRNewswire/ -- The United States Surgeon General, Dr. Vivek Murthy, issued the first-ever Surgeon General's report on addiction on Thursday.Dr. Murthy stated that he intends for the report to galvanize support to change drug policy in the United States in the way that a similar report over 50 years ago accelerated efforts to combat opioid.Dr. Michael H. Lowenstein, Medical Director of the Waismann Method Medical Group, supports the Surgeon General's efforts and is enthusiastic about the prospect of changing the way we view and treat substance abuse in the United States.

For the first time ever, a sitting U.S. surgeon general has declared substance abuse a public-health crisis."It's time to change how we view addiction," Vivek Murthy said in a statement last week, which was accompanied by a lengthy report on the issue."Not as a moral failing, but as a chronic illness that must be treated with skill, urgency and compassion.

Staff ReporterSubmitted byon 11/26/2016 - 16:48.A new state survey shows fewer Alaska teens are engaging in cigarette, alcohol and drug use.AP reports that the Alaska Youth Risk Behavior Survey shows students across the state have reported declines in opioid, substance use, riding with an impaired driver, sexual activity and fighting.
